Kyle Rushton is a Lake County Firefighter. His son's name is Logan. He has a condition known as polymicrogyria that has affected his left temporal and partial frontal lobes as well as the right temporal lobe. This condition causes an excess of gyria (folds in the brain) that leads to seizures and delayed development. Currently the cause of the condition is unknown, and the only treatments for it are medicine to control the seizures or brain surgery to remove the affected areas. He was diagnosed in April and is currently being treated with medication, with promising results. If the medication does not work, the next step is the surgery. The neurologist will be monitoring his progress over the next several months to determine if this is necessary. Either way, this condition will have lifelong consequences. Luckily his case seems to be on the lower end of the spectrum as far as the symptoms. There are children that have much worse symptoms, some to the extent that they cannot even eat solid foods. His condition could still worsen to this point, but the neurologist seems to think that is not likely. Any and all help for Logan is GREATLY appreciated.
